  • University of Oxford: A historic institution steeped in tradition, the University of Oxford offers a glimpse into 900 years of academic excellence. Just 322m from St Cross College, wander through its stunning architecture and experience the vibrant cultural atmosphere that permeates its halls.
  • Christ Church College: Located 805m away, Christ Church College is not only a church but also an iconic part of Oxford's heritage. Its beautiful gardens and grand dining hall, which inspired Hogwarts, provide a unique cultural experience that is a must-see.
  • Bodleian Library: Situated 483m from St Cross College, the Bodleian Library is one of the oldest libraries in Europe. With its vast collection and stunning architecture, it offers a family-friendly environment rich in culture, perfect for book lovers and history enthusiasts alike.

Best time to go to St Cross College

The best time to visit St Cross College can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around St Cross College fal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around St Cross College fal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to St Cross College

Visiting St Cross College in Oxford is convenient with access to several major airports. London Heathrow (LHR) is approximately 64.4km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Sofitel London Heathrow, located 3.2km from the airport. Birmingham Airport (BHX) is around 53.2km distant, offering options such as the 5-star Hampton Manor, just 3.2km away. London Luton (LTN) is about 62.8km from St Cross College, with excellent accommodations like the 5-star Luton Hoo Hotel, Golf and Spa, situated 3.2km from the airport.
